We have investigated the phase transition behaviors and carrier transport properties of novel electron-deficient calamitic liquid crystalline organic semiconductors based on dibenzo[c,h][2,6]naphthyridine (DBN) core, i.e., dialkylated side chain DBN of 2,8-didecyl-DBN (C10-DBN-C10), mono-side chain DBN of 2-decyl-DBN, and unsymmetrical substituted DBN of 2-chloro-8-decyl-DBN. Two of them exhibited low ordered smectic liquid crystal, SmC and SmA phases. The mobility of C10-DBN-C10 in SmC phase depended on electric field and temperature, which indicated the hopping transport of hole and electron in SmC phase of C10-DBN-C10 in energetic disordered system.
